3-bromoprop-1-yne
Also Known As: 3-Bromopropyne, PROPARGYL BROMIDE, 3-bromoprop-1-yne, 3-Bromo-1-propyne, Propynyl bromide

| Molecular Formula | C3H3Br |
| Molecular Weight | 117.94181 g/mol |
| XLogP | 1.1 |
|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) | 0.0 Ų |
| Hydrogen Bond Donors | 0 |
| Hydrogen Bond Acceptors | 0 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 0 |
| Exact Mass | 117.94181 Da |
| Heavy Atoms | 4 |
| Complexity | 38.0 |
| Melting Point | -77.9 °F (EPA, 1998) |
| Boiling Point | 190 to 194 °F at 760 mmHg (EPA, 1998) |
| Density | 1.564 to 1.57 (EPA, 1998) |
| Flash Point | 50 °F (EPA, 1998) |
| Vapor Pressure | 108.0 [mmHg] |
| Refractive Index | Index of refraction = 1.4922 at 20 °C |
| Solubility | Soluble in ethanol, ether, benzene, carbon tetrachloride, and chloroform |
| SMILES | C#CCBr |
| InChIKey | YORCIIVHUBAYBQ-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
Applications: Propargyl bromide is used in heterocycle construction in medicinal chemistry and agrochemical discovery, as well as pharmaceutical synthesis routes and API production. It commonly serves as a versatile building block for organic synthesis.
